At some point, I discovered a job posting web – a dating internet site had been wanting to employ people supervisors. Back then, “community therapy” had been simply for moderating statements, posting emails and fundamentally ensuring group weren’t going batshit ridiculous on forums. I applied, figuring this is some thing i possibly could do in order to distract myself personally while bored workplace. (plainly simple integrity weren’t the thing that good at the age of 20.)

Minimum and view, i acquired work.

Work looked simple enough: Having been in making a shape on the site and “make other people feeling welcome” … whatever that designed. I poked in on the site to make certain it absolutely wasn’t such a thing sleazy and affirmed it absolutely was just a fundamental, typical dating website – not just unlike OKCupid or Match.com. I happened to be supplied lifeless afford of $300 each week – pretty good for a side concert I was working on while at work. As soon as I’d already finalized the acquire together with eventually gotten full rules, they reach me:

I’d just taken a career as dating internet site trap.

After a day, this fabulous website would give information to people over at my sake. Not just a handful of – numerous emails. The reason why? Quick: it was no-cost for women to come aboard your website. Men, but wanted to shell out. Quite simply, boys would create the free of charge accounts, discover they’d was given a message from a lovely 20 year-old woman, desire would have the best of those, and they’d cover account.

Yeah – fairly poor. An excellent growth go on their own part – but essentially, only form of bad and morally shady.

I asked this, and was actually told by the founders of these site it ended up being perfectly lawful, as most of these males was indeed updated that I was only an “online ambassador” with regards to their webpages. “The truth is,” these people pointed out “your page will blatantly claim ‘Online Ambassador’ – so you shouldn’t be concerned.”

Get back assurance, we dove right in.

From the first day, I really reckoned it was type of exciting. I experienced was given about 70 information – absolutely manageable – and spent the trip to succeed keying considerate answers every single content.

Time two? A little chaotic – I was given just a few hundred communications. Nevertheless, nothing too ridiculous – and it also would be retaining myself used.

In the day time hours three, but facts obtained… extreme. I had was given over 500 information – in addition to order to keep consitently the gig, I’d to react to each and every content in 24 hours or less. Reported on my personal “manager”, the very best objective was to keep on these males as spending customers so long as feasible. Inside her terminology, I happened to be purported to cycle all of them down, have sugar daddy dating them keep on log in, and finally – make sure they are adore me. However, I had been not to offer any particular website information, therefore they’d have to always keep having to pay their unique ongoing charge only to look after our very own “relationship” …yes, awful.

The amount of messages we got on a daily basis matured higher and better until I happened to be receiving several thousand information day to day. Every night, some sort of message (we never ever have determine what it absolutely was) would be sent from the account to every unmarried man that had have ever licensed when it comes to internet site, but had often terminated her remunerated pub, or never compensated before everything else.
